If you do paint your car, remember to get a good spray gun, use good paint, make sure you have a big *** compressor, and remember these three words: Prep, prep, prep. The more work you do in the prep stage, the better it will turn out. "When you think you're done prepping, you're about half way there".

I learned a few of these truths the hard way.
